Table 1.

The five rounds of the ARISTOTLE programme: duration, number of participants and demographics.

Round A Round B Round C Round D Round E
Time period of recruitment 20 August 2012–29 October 2012 4 December 2012–1 March 2013 19 March 2013–7 June 2013 17 June 2013–11 September 2013 19 September 2013–16 December 2013
Duration of recruitment (weeks) 10.0 12.4 11.4 12.3 12.6
Maximum number of recruitment waves achieved 9a 23 19 18 20
Number of seeds 11 6 5 7 6
Number of participants
 All participants 1415 1444 1434 1413 1407
 First-time participants, n (%) 1415 (100.0) 766 (53.1) 458 (31.9) 370 (26.2) 311 (22.1)
 Repeat participants, n (%) 0 (0.0) 678 (46.9) 976 (68.1) 1043 (73.8) 1096 (77.9)
Age, mean (SD)
 All participants 35.5 (7.8) 35.9 (8.2) 36.2 (8.1) 36.3 (8.0) 36.3 (7.9)
 First-time participants 35.5 (7.8) 36.0 (8.8) 36.3 (8.8) 36.1 (8.7) 35.5 (8.2)
Repeat participants 35.7 (7.5) 36.2 (7.8) 36.5 (7.7) 36.6 (7.8)
Male, n (%)
 All participants 1206 (85.2) 1198 (83.0) 1185 (82.6) 1153 (81.6) 1153 (82.0)
 First-time participants 1206 (85.2) 631 (82.4) 392 (85.6) 316 (85.4) 261 (83.9)
 Repeat participants 567 (83.6) 793 (81.3) 837 (80.3) 892 (81.4)
a

In round A, a 10-digit number was allowed for in the coupons where the first one or two digits identified the seed and the remaining digits identified the waves. Thus, up to nine waves were allowed for in the recruitment. Since round B, this limit in the coupon numbering was removed. SD = standard deviation.
